Honor Magic 3 Pro to Come on August 12 with Snapdragon 888+

Honor is getting ready to introduce its new Magic 3 series on August 12. This smartphone would feature the Snapdragon 888+.

According to the source, we have some interesting news about the Magic 3 Pro. These tips came from a tipster and should be taken merely as an expectation rather than confirmation.

According to the tipster, this new Pro model would have a 1228P high-resolution sensor. There would be a quadruple rear camera setup with the main sensor denoting the 48MP feature. Its size is said to be 1/1.5 inches and will work with a telephoto lens with support for 100x digital zoom.

Under the hood, we would get a Snapdragon 888+ chipset. The device would also feature a 110W fast-wired charging support. It would also receive wireless charging support of 50W.

We also heard that this Magic 3 series has already reached TENAA under the codenames ELZ-AN00, ELZ-AN10, and ELZ-AN20.

In addition to this, we heard more rumors about this smartphone that stated that this device would have 8 cores “with a maximum clock speed of 3 GHz, an Adreno 660 graphics accelerator and a Snapdragon X60 5G modem with data transfer rates up to 7.5 Gbps.”

The device would also feature a 6.76-inch OLED display with a resolution of 2772 x 1344 pixels.
